Abstract
457,612. Piston-rings. W.P. (LYMING- TON), Ltd., and HOWLETT, J. W., Radial Works, Stanford Road, Lymington, Hampshire.-(Simplex Piston Ring Co. of Amer., Inc. ; 1966, East 66th Street, Cleveland, Ohio, U.S.A.) June 1, 1935, Nos. 15976 and 21836. [Class 122 (i)] A piston - ring comprises a bearing surface of steel, having a scleroscope hardness of between 25 and 65, and a harder steel or cast iron backing spring which is between 1À2 to 3À5 times harder than the bearing surface. The soft steel may be cemented dovetailed or deposited electrolytically on the spring. Alternatively, a steel ring may have its inner periphery casehardened to provide the spring portion. The soft steel ring may comprise laminations 7 backed by a wave spring 4 and bevelled or set back from the cylinder wall to provide oil channels. The groove depth may be regulated by shims 3. Relative rotation of the laminations is prevented by projections 10 thereon engaging between the waves of the spring, or the latter may engage in aligned recesses in the laminations. The soft steel may be inserted in a groove 13 in a cast iron spring 4, Fig. 9. Specification 427,256 is referred to.
